Q9M5K3: Dihydrolipoyl dehydrogenase 1, mitochondrial

General Information

Protein names
- Dihydrolipoyl dehydrogenase 1, mitochondrial
- AtmLPD1
- mtLPD1
- 1.8.1.4
- Dihydrolipoamide dehydrogenase 1
- Glycine cleavage system L protein 1
- Pyruvate dehydrogenase complex E3 subunit 1
- E3-1
- PDC-E3 1

Gene names LPD1
Organism Arabidopsis thaliana
